net/sonic: Clear interrupt flags immediately



The chip can change a packet's descriptor status flags at any time.
However, an active interrupt flag gets cleared rather late. This
allows a race condition that could theoretically lose an interrupt.
Fix this by clearing asserted interrupt flags immediately.

Fixes: efcce839 ("[PATCH] macsonic/jazzsonic network drivers update")
